| 2 | #ifndef _3DS_PTHREAD_WRAP__ |
| 3 | #define _3DS_PTHREAD_WRAP__ |
| 4 | |
| 5 | #include <stdlib.h> |
| 6 | #include <string.h> |
| 7 | #include <stdio.h> |
| 8 | |
| 9 | #include "3ds_utils.h" |
| 10 | |
| 11 | #define CTR_PTHREAD_STACK_SIZE 0x10000 |
| 12 | #define FALSE 0 |
| 13 | |
| 14 | typedef int32_t pthread_t; |
| 15 | typedef int pthread_attr_t; |
| 16 | |
| 17 | typedef LightLock pthread_mutex_t; |
| 18 | typedef int pthread_mutexattr_t; |
| 19 | |
| 20 | typedef struct { |
| 21 | uint32_t semaphore; |
| 22 | LightLock lock; |
| 23 | uint32_t waiting; |
| 24 | } pthread_cond_t; |
| 25 | |
| 26 | typedef int pthread_condattr_t; |
| 27 | |
| 28 | static inline int pthread_create(pthread_t *thread, |
| 29 | const pthread_attr_t *attr, void *(*start_routine)(void*), void *arg) |
| 30 | { |
| 31 | int procnum = -2; // use default cpu |
| 32 | bool isNew3DS; |
| 33 | APT_CheckNew3DS(&isNew3DS); |
| 34 | |
| 35 | if (isNew3DS) |
| 36 | procnum = 2; |
| 37 | |
| 38 | *thread = threadCreate(start_routine, arg, CTR_PTHREAD_STACK_SIZE, 0x25, procnum, FALSE); |
| 39 | return 0; |
| 40 | } |
| 41 | |
| 42 | |
| 43 | static inline int pthread_join(pthread_t thread, void **retval) |
| 44 | { |
| 45 | (void)retval; |
| 46 | |
| 47 | if(threadJoin(thread, INT64_MAX)) |
| 48 | return -1; |
| 49 | |
| 50 | threadFree(thread); |
| 51 | |
| 52 | return 0; |
| 53 | } |
| 54 | |
| 55 | |
| 56 | static inline void pthread_exit(void *retval) |
| 57 | { |
| 58 | (void)retval; |
| 59 | |
| 60 | threadExit(0); |
| 61 | } |
| 62 | |
| 63 | static inline int pthread_mutex_init(pthread_mutex_t *mutex, const pthread_mutexattr_t *attr) { |
| 64 | LightLock_Init(mutex); |
| 65 | return 0; |
| 66 | } |
| 67 | |
| 68 | static inline int pthread_mutex_lock(pthread_mutex_t *mutex) { |
| 69 | LightLock_Lock(mutex); |
| 70 | return 0; |
| 71 | } |
| 72 | |
| 73 | static inline int pthread_mutex_unlock(pthread_mutex_t *mutex) { |
| 74 | LightLock_Unlock(mutex); |
| 75 | return 0; |
| 76 | } |
| 77 | |
| 78 | static inline int pthread_mutex_destroy(pthread_mutex_t *mutex) { |
| 79 | return 0; |
| 80 | } |
| 81 | |
| 82 | static inline int pthread_cond_init(pthread_cond_t *cond, const pthread_condattr_t *attr) { |
| 83 | if (svcCreateSemaphore(&cond->semaphore, 0, 1)) |
| 84 | goto error; |
| 85 | |
| 86 | LightLock_Init(&cond->lock); |
| 87 | cond->waiting = 0; |
| 88 | return 0; |
| 89 | |
| 90 | error: |
| 91 | svcCloseHandle(cond->semaphore); |
| 92 | return -1; |
| 93 | } |
| 94 | |
| 95 | static inline int pthread_cond_signal(pthread_cond_t *cond) { |
| 96 | int32_t count; |
| 97 | LightLock_Lock(&cond->lock); |
| 98 | if (cond->waiting) { |
| 99 | cond->waiting--; |
| 100 | svcReleaseSemaphore(&count, cond->semaphore, 1); |
| 101 | } |
| 102 | LightLock_Unlock(&cond->lock); |
| 103 | return 0; |
| 104 | } |
| 105 | |
| 106 | static inline int pthread_cond_wait(pthread_cond_t *cond, pthread_mutex_t *lock) { |
| 107 | LightLock_Lock(&cond->lock); |
| 108 | cond->waiting++; |
| 109 | LightLock_Unlock(lock); |
| 110 | LightLock_Unlock(&cond->lock); |
| 111 | svcWaitSynchronization(cond->semaphore, INT64_MAX); |
| 112 | LightLock_Lock(lock); |
| 113 | return 0; |
| 114 | } |
| 115 | |
| 116 | static inline int pthread_cond_destroy(pthread_cond_t *cond) { |
| 117 | svcCloseHandle(cond->semaphore); |
| 118 | return 0; |
| 119 | } |
| 120 | |
| 121 | |
| 122 | #endif //_3DS_PTHREAD_WRAP__ |
